  7. 7

    larse

    to get out, to clear off, to leave quickly
    expressioncolloquial

    Colloquial verb meaning to leave abruptly, often used as an imperative (¡Lárgate!) to tell someone to get out. The root largar carries a sense of urgency or dismissal that the neutral 'irse' does not.

    Si no quieres escucharme, lárgate de una vez y déjame tranquila.If you don't want to listen to me, clear off already and leave me alone.

  9. 9

    espabilar

    to get a move on, to wake up and get on with it
    expressioncolloquial

    Used to urge someone to hurry up or stop dawdling. It can also mean to wise up or stop being naive. Context determines which nuance applies; tone usually makes it clear.

    ¡Espabila, que llevamos veinte minutos esperándote!Get a move on, we've been waiting for you for twenty minutes!
  10. 10

    se va a liar

    things are going to kick off, it's going to get messy
    expressioncolloquial

    Liar in this sense means to create chaos, conflict, or a complicated situation. 'Se va a liar' warns that trouble or disorder is about to happen, without any literal tying or tangling.

    Con esos dos en la misma reunión, seguro que se va a liar.With those two in the same meeting, things are bound to kick off.
